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region

Substitute Teachers in Geneva, Alabama, play a crucial role in maintaining educational continuity when regular teachers are unavailable. - Entry-level Substitute Teacher salaries range from $25,000 to $30,000 per year - Mid-career Substitute Teacher salaries range from $30,000 to $40,000 per year - Senior Substitute Educator salaries range from $40,000 to $55,000 per year The role of substitute teaching in Geneva has been essential for many years, ensuring that education proceeds seamlessly despite the absence of regular classroom teachers. Over time, the expectations and responsibilities of Substitute Teachers in Geneva have evolved significantly. Initially seen as merely temporary stand-ins, they are now recognized as vital contributors to the educational process, often bringing unique skills and perspectives to the classroom. Today, trends in substitute teaching in Geneva are moving towards more professional development opportunities and increased support from school administrations. This shift aims to enhance the effectiveness of Substitute Teachers and improve the quality of education that students receive during the absence of their regular teachers.
